10 ADVANCED POSITIONING CONTROL
10.3.8 Repeated start (FOR condition)
In a "repeated start (FOR condition)", the data between the "start block data" in which
"6: FOR condition" is set in "
Da.12 Special start command" and the "start block data"
in which "7: NEXT start" is set in "
Da.12 Special start command" is repeatedly
executed until the establishment of the conditions set in the "condition data".
The condition is evaluated at the time of change to the point of "7: NEXT start" (just
before the positioning control for the point of NEXT start).
(The "condition data" designation is set in "
Da.13 Parameter" of the "start block data"
in which "6: FOR condition" is set in "
Da.12 Special start command".)
Section (2) shows a control example where the "start block data" and "positioning data"
are set as shown in section (1).

(2) Control examples
The following shows the control executed when the "start block data" of the 1st
point of axis 1 is set as shown in section (1) and started.
<1> Perform the processing of "positioning data No. 1, 2, 3, 10, and 11" of the
axis 1.
<2> Evaluate the condition set in "condition data No. 5" of the axis 1.
*1
Conditions not established Perform the processing of "positioning
data No. 50 and 51", and go to <1>.
Conditions established Perform the processing of "positioning data
No. 50 and 51", and complete the positioning.
*1 The condition is evaluated at the time of change to the point of NEXT start (just
before the positioning control for the point of NEXT start).
